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
328388626 46294092196 364721 5598853 0709
993 71867 89521
993 71867 89521
173125 385905411 779950 923804 14559944819
All about undefined
Interested in learning more?
993 71867 89521
173125 385905411 779950 923804 14559944819
See more
9338907545 54 7760268
4330964 229 663419571
See more
0795427028 6960288608 388270164
4040 84 3302
See more